归并排序是一种稳定的排序方法,它的时间复杂度为O(nlogn)。
它的中心思想就是,对数组中的元素分成两部分,然后对两部分分别排好序后,再归并在一起。
代码如下:
run success at the DEV develop environment.
本文介绍了一种稳定且高效排序算法——归并排序。该算法采用分治策略将数组分为两个子数组,递归地对子数组进行排序,然后将两个有序数组合并成一个有序数组。文章提供了完整的C++实现代码,并通过一个示例演示了如何使用该算法对数组进行排序。
归并排序是一种稳定的排序方法,它的时间复杂度为O(nlogn)。
它的中心思想就是,对数组中的元素分成两部分,然后对两部分分别排好序后,再归并在一起。
代码如下:
run success at the DEV develop environment.
6万+

被折叠的 条评论
为什么被折叠?